جدول المحتويات:

روبوت إرسال البريد باستخدام Python: 5 خطوات
روبوت إرسال البريد باستخدام Python: 5 خطوات

فيديو: روبوت إرسال البريد باستخدام Python: 5 خطوات

فيديو: روبوت إرسال البريد باستخدام Python: 5 خطوات
فيديو: أعلى مستوى وصلتوا في البرمجة 2024, شهر نوفمبر
Anonim
إرسال البريد الإلكتروني باستخدام Python
إرسال البريد الإلكتروني باستخدام Python

في هذا المشروع سوف تتعلم كيفية إرسال الرسائل باستخدام لغة python ، وهنا قمت بشرح مشروع يمكن استخدامه لمعرفة ما إذا كان لديك حضور كاف لأخذ إجازة من الكلية / المدرسة أم لا. 75٪.

الخطوة الأولى: حساب نسبة الحضور

حساب نسبة الحضور
حساب نسبة الحضور

لقد استخدمت هنا بعض الترميز الأساسي لحساب الحضور. عندما نقوم بتجميع الكود أولاً ، نضع العدد الإجمالي للفصول ثم عدد الفصول الدراسية (أعلم أنه لن يستيقظ أحد ويستخدم كود الثعبان هذا لمعرفة هذا الحضور ولكن يمكن الحكم عليه لمشاريعك الأخرى)

الخطوة 2: إرسال البريد الإلكتروني

بوت إرسال البريد
بوت إرسال البريد
بوت إرسال البريد
بوت إرسال البريد

خطوات:-

1) نقوم باستيراد جميع المتغيرات من كود بيثون الحضور أعلاه.

2) نقوم باستيراد "smtplib" لجلسة عميل SMTP لاستخدامها في إرسال البريد إلى أي جهاز إنترنت باستخدام SMTP.

3) نصنع ملفًا آخر باسم "config" يقوم بتخزين معرف gmail وكلمة المرور. (لقد استخدمت gmail ، يمكنك استخدام أي خدمة بريد إلكتروني أخرى)

4) الترميز لإرسال بريد مع الموضوع وكذلك الرسالة.

5) في الصورة الأولى الموضحة هناك متطلبات مسبقة لإرسال بريد. في الصورة الثانية قمنا بترميز لإرسال بريد مع بعض البيانات المحددة مثل موضوع مكتوب مسبقًا ونص البريد الإلكتروني ، لقد أضفت هنا للتو بضعة أسطر ولكن يمكنك تحريرها لأداء المزيد من المهام.

6) لقد استخدمت عبارات if and else لإرسال بريد ما إذا كان يجب أن أذهب إلى الفصل أم لا.

الخطوة 3: إنشاء ملف Python لتخزين بيانات اعتماد Gmail الخاصة بك

إنشاء ملف Python لتخزين بيانات اعتماد Gmail الخاصة بك
إنشاء ملف Python لتخزين بيانات اعتماد Gmail الخاصة بك

قم بإنشاء كود python يسمى config وقم بتخزين البيانات كما هو موضح أعلاه.

الخطوة 4: أخيرا

أخيرا!!
أخيرا!!

سوف تتلقى بريدًا مثل هذا.

حظا سعيدا !!

الخطوة الخامسة:

هذه هي الرموز المطلوبة.

لقد كتبت هذا البرنامج النصي في الواقع لمشروع آخر حيث إذا دخل شخص ما إلى غرفة فسوف نتلقى بريدًا إلكترونيًا ويمكننا إرسال بريد لتغيير كلمة المرور لقفل الباب والذي سيتم إجراؤه باستخدام raspberry pi و arduino.

يمكنك استخدامه لمشاريعك أيضًا.

موصى به: